Build Your Deck Faster With Helical Piers in Maryland

Helical piers are large steel screws that are mechanically driven into the ground to serve as deep foundational anchors. Unlike concrete footers that require digging, forming, pouring, and curing, helical piers go in fast—and are ready to build on immediately.


⏱️ 30 Minutes Per Pier, Not 3 Days Per Footer

Traditional footers require excavation, inspection, concrete delivery, and several days to cure before framing can begin. In contrast, helical piers can be installed in as little as 30 minutes per pier—no waiting, no weather delays, no concrete trucks.

Once the pier is in the ground and torque-verified, your team can start building that same day. That’s a huge win for contractors trying to stay on schedule—or get ahead of it.

📦 Less Mess, Fewer Delays

Helical piers eliminate the most disruptive part of a foundation job:

  • No trenching

  • No spoil removal

  • No concrete spills

  • No rescheduling due to rain or soft ground

That means less cleanup, less equipment, and less risk of pushing your timeline out a week or more due to conditions beyond your control.


🔩 One-Bolt Connections Speed Up Framing

Some helical pier systems—like those used by our team at Design Builders—are engineered with simplified connection points that use just one structural bolt per bracket. That may not sound like much, but across a project with 10–20 piers, it can save hours of labor and reduce potential alignment issues.

With fewer components to align and fasten, your crew gets to framing faster and with more precision.
